The highboard was made in the 1960s, danish production. The structure is covered with teak veneer. Legs and handles are made of solid wood. Surface after refreshing. Inside the space has been filled with four practical shelves with height adjustment and three drawers. Highboard has a convenient solution of sliding doors, which reduces the need to leave a large free space in front of the furniture without restricting access to its interior. Another advantage is the bar with a decorative mirror and drawer. Condition: the surface of the furniture after refreshing. Visible small scratches and filled veneer losses.
